The initial phase of building a metal scaffold factory begins with site selection. A strategic location, often near transportation hubs, is crucial to ensure seamless logistics and easy access to raw materials. The site should have ample space to accommodate not only the manufacturing plant but also storage facilities, offices, and testing areas. Once the site is secured, the next step involves designing the factory layout. It's essential to consider the flow of materials, from the receipt of raw steel to the finished product. The layout should promote efficiency, allowing for smooth production lines and minimal downtime. Modern, automated systems should be integrated wherever possible to increase productivity and maintain quality standards. The heart of any metal scaffold factory is its machinery. State-of-the-art equipment, including cutting machines, welding robots, and paint booths, are necessary for high-quality production. These machines must be regularly maintained and upgraded to keep up with industry advancements and safety regulations. Safety, both in the manufacturing process and in the final product, is paramount. The factory must adhere to stringent safety guidelines, ensuring all employees are trained in proper handling and operation of machinery. Additionally, the metal scaffolds produced should undergo rigorous testing to guarantee their structural integrity.
